LOS ANGELES, Cal. - The big day is finally here for American Idol finalists Lauren Alaina and Scotty McCreery, but what songs they’ll sing in Tuesday night’s all-country finale performances remains a mystery.
Both Lauren and Scotty will sing three songs on the final performance show of the season, which begins at 8 p.m. EST on FOX. One of those songs will be chosen by their personal music idols. Idol Season 4 winner Carrie Underwood selected Lauren’s song, and country music icon George Strait picked one for Scotty.
Scotty and Lauren will also sing their favorite song from the season, and they’ll perform their debut single, which was selected for them by Idol producers. The rest, will of course, be up to America in the final vote of the season.
